How We Extract Water in Helena, MS – Our Process
With emergency water extraction, our process is designed to be as stress-free as possible. We’ll start by assessing the damage, identifying the source of the water, and creating a plan to remove it. Our team will then use advanced equipment to extract the water, dry the affected areas, and disinfect to prevent further damage.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We begin by assessing the damage and identifying the source of the water. We’ll create a plan to remove the water and dry affected areas. Our team will also check for any signs of mold or mildew.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use advanced equipment to extract the water from your property. This may involve using wet vacuums, pumps, or other specialized tools to remove the water.
Step 3: Drying and Disinfecting
Once the water is removed, we’ll use specialized equipment to dry affected areas. We’ll also disinfect to prevent further damage and growth of mold or mildew.
Step 4: Final Inspection and Cleanup
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ure everything is dry and in good condition. We’ll also remove any debris or materials that were damaged by the water.

Warning Signs of Water Damage You Shouldn’t Ignore
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ant odors in your home or business can be a sign of water damage. If you notice a musty smell that won’t go away, it’s essential to investigate further. Our team can help you identify the source of the odor and provide a solution to pr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
If you notice your flooring is warped or buckled, it could be a sign of water damage. Our team can assess the damage and provide a solution to repair or replace the affected areas.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Water stains on ceilings or walls can be a sign of water damage. If you notice these stains, it’s crucial to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age. Our team can assess the damage and provide a solution to repair or replace the affected areas.

Emergency Water Extraction v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Standing water in small areas (less than 10 sq. Ft.) | Yes | No | DIY is fine for small areas, but be cautious not to spread the water or create electrical hazards. |
| Standing water in large areas (more than 10 sq. Ft.) | No | Yes | Large areas need specialized equipment and expertise to remove safely and efficiently. |
| Water damage from burst pipes | No | Yes | Burst pipes can cause extensive damage and need specialized equipment to repair. |
| Water damage from flooding | No | Yes | Flooding needs specialized equipment and expertise to remove water and dry affected areas. |
| Water damage from appliance failure | Maybe | Yes | Appliance failure can cause water damage, but the extent of the damage may need a professional assessment. |
| Water damage on ceilings or walls | No | Yes | Water damage on ceilings or walls can be a sign of hidden problems and need a professional assessment. |

Emergency Water Extraction Cost in Helena, MS
The cost of emergency water extraction in Helena, MS can vary based on the severity of the damage, size of affected areas, and local conditions. Our prices start at $500 and can go up to $2,500 or more, depending on the extent of the damage.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$1,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Disinfecting and sanitizing | $200 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of materials affected |
| Equipment rental and usage | $100 – $300 | Type of equipment used, rental duration |
| Removal of damaged materials | $500 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ials |
| Final inspection and cleanup | $200 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of materials |
